Strathfield Motel

In response to a request for information about the Strathfield Motel on Albert Road Strathfield.  I can’t find much information, except that it was built c.1967 and demolished in 1995.  The street address was 22 Albert Road Strathfield.  In 1995, the Motel and other adjacent properties were acquired on Albert Road and Churchill Avenue and demolished. Meriton Apartments are built on this site.

The photo below is a photo of the Strathfield Town Centre in 1972, with the location of the Motel indicated on the map.  It appears that this building was the highest building in Strathfield in its day.
